NATO delegation visits Azerbaijani Naval Forces [PHOTO]


By Fatima Hasanova

On November 24, representatives of NATO’s Supreme Headquarters
Allied Powers Europe (SHAPE), who’re on a go to to Azerbaijan as
a part of the NATO Days, visited Azerbaijani Naval Forces, Azernews
reviews, citing the Azerbaijani Protection Ministry.

The company got a briefing on the historical past and actions
of the Azerbaijani Naval Forces.

Then representatives of NATO’s SHAPE delivered speeches on
varied matters masking the historical past of the institution,
construction, and common actions of NATO.

After the displays, questions of mutual curiosity had been
answered.

Relations with NATO began in 1992 when Azerbaijan joined the
North Atlantic Cooperation Council. This discussion board for dialogue was
succeeded in 1997 by the Euro-Atlantic Partnership Council, which
brings collectively all allies and companion international locations within the
Euro-Atlantic space.

Bilateral cooperation started when Azerbaijan joined the
Partnership for Peace (PfP) program in 1994. Due to common
participation in PfP actions, Azerbaijan has been capable of
contribute actively to Euro-Atlantic safety by supporting
NATO-led peace-support operations.

Azerbaijan’s participation within the PfP Planning and Overview
Course of (PARP) since 1997 has enabled NATO and particular person allies to
help Azerbaijan in creating chosen models to enhance
interoperability with these of the allies.

NATO and Azerbaijan began work on a collectively agreed Protection
Training Enhancement Program (DEEP) in 2008 to combine NATO
requirements into the educating methodologies and curricula of the
nation’s Skilled Army Training (PME) establishments.

In 2018, Azerbaijan requested NATO to additionally contain the Army Excessive
Faculty, a pre-commissioning college, in DEEP.
